Интеграция amoCRM и 1С в 2026: что часто ломается и как не платить дважды
Считается, что интеграция amoCRM с 1С это галочка в проекте. Купил готовый коннектор, нажал "включить", сделка автоматом превращается в реализацию, остатки летают между системами. На демо у вендора так и есть. В реальном бизнесе через две недели после запуска менеджеры начинают звонить разработчику с фразами вроде "у меня сделка проводится, но в 1С ничего не приходит" или "1С отдаёт 0 на остатке, а на сайте написано 15".
Я уже три года склеиваю amoCRM с 1С под разные бизнесы: оптовые компании, дистрибьюторы, e-commerce, b2b-услуги. Рассказываю, где интеграция ломается чаще всего и как считать смету, чтобы потом не доплачивать в три раза от исходной цены.
Что вообще даёт нормальная интеграция amoCRM и 1С
Если упростить, два сценария.
Базовый. Сделка из amoCRM закрывается, в 1С создаётся документ реализации с номенклатурой, количеством, ценой и контрагентом. Менеджер не дублирует руками. Бухгалтер закрывает месяц по реальным цифрам, а не по выгрузкам из Excel. Это минимум, ради которого вообще делают интеграцию.
Расширенный. Кроме сделок едут остатки и цены из 1С в amoCRM, чтобы менеджер видел "товар есть, можем продавать" прямо в карточке. Контрагенты синхронизируются обратно из 1С в amoCRM, чтобы при повторной сделке не плодились дубли. Платежи и закрывашки приезжают в amoCRM как комментарии или поля, чтобы РОП не лазал в 1С за каждой циферкой.
Бизнес обычно начинает с базовой схемы, через месяц-два просит расширенную. И вот здесь начинаются разговоры про доплату, потому что коробочные коннекторы расширенную схему тянут плохо.
Где интеграция реально ломается (топ-7 граблей)
1. Структура номенклатуры в 1С не совпадает с тем, что менеджер выбирает в сделке
В amoCRM продают "Услуга монтажа" одной строкой. В 1С эта услуга разбита на три: материалы, работа, доп. сервис. Когда коннектор пытается сопоставить, он либо валится, либо выбирает первый попавшийся пункт. Бухгалтерия потом перепроводит вручную.
Лечится только до интеграции - нормализацией справочника номенклатуры и созданием правил маппинга. В смету сразу закладывайте 4-12 часов работы аналитика на этот этап. Если этот шаг пропустили, готовьтесь к двум-трём итерациям доводки уже после запуска.
2. Контрагенты дублируются
amoCRM создаёт сделку с контактом "Иван Петров" и компанией "Стройка ООО". В 1С такой контрагент уже есть как "Стройка ООО, ИНН 770xxxxxx", но без идеального совпадения по названию. Коннектор не находит совпадения, создаёт нового контрагента, у вас в 1С появляются две карточки. Через год дубли есть у каждого второго клиента, а сводный отчёт по продажам сбоит.
Решается через сверку по ИНН плюс ручное правило "если ИНН совпадает, обновляем существующего, не создаём нового". Большинство коробок такое правило не умеют из коробки.
3. amoCRM не видит, что в 1С что-то поменялось
Менеджер закрыл сделку, документ реализации создан. Бухгалтер потом нашёл ошибку в количестве и поправил в 1С. amoCRM об этом не знает. Через полгода РОП смотрит отчёт в amoCRM, бухгалтер смотрит отчёт в 1С, цифры расходятся на 7%.
Двусторонняя синхронизация это отдельный проект, дороже односторонней в полтора-два раза. Часто заказчик про это узнаёт уже после запуска.
4. Цены полетели не туда
В 1С три типа цен: розница, опт, мелкий опт. В amoCRM подгрузили все три, и в момент создания сделки нужно выбрать правильный. Коробочный коннектор обычно выбирает либо одну фиксированную, либо последнюю изменённую. Менеджер выставил счёт по опту, в 1С документ упал с розничной ценой, недостача 15%.
5. Сделка проведена, в 1С пусто
Самая частая жалоба. Сделка успешно закрылась в amoCRM, должна была улететь в 1С, но не улетела. Причин куча: сессия 1С отвалилась, в номенклатуре не нашёл соответствие, контрагент не создался из-за ИНН, отвалился webhook между системами. Без нормального логирования отдельных событий обмена вы это узнаёте, только когда бухгалтер не находит документ.
Сразу закладывайте в смету логи обмена с алертами в Telegram или почту. Это +10-20 тысяч рублей к проекту, экономит сотни тысяч на разборах.
6. 1С работает медленно или висит
Особенно типично для коробочной 1С на сервере клиента, не в облаке. Сделка ушла из amoCRM в 1С, а 1С 30 секунд её обрабатывает (или вообще timeout). Коннектор повторил запрос, в 1С появились два документа.
Идемпотентность (защита от повторов) либо встроена, либо реализована руками с проверкой по уникальному ID сделки. Без неё дубликаты документов вылазят пачками.
7. Поломали при обновлении 1С
Каждое обновление платформы или конфигурации 1С может сломать внешнюю обработку, через которую идёт обмен. У одного из моих клиентов после обновления 1С 8.3.22 → 8.3.24 коннектор молча перестал принимать сделки. Потеряли неделю продаж, пока я не заметил.
Лечится регулярными тестами обмена (раз в неделю синтетическая сделка через тестового контрагента) и договором на поддержку. Без поддержки обновляться придётся осторожно.
Сколько это реально стоит
Разделю на три тарифа, чтобы было с чем сравнивать.
Готовый коробочный коннектор. Класс a-la "1С-Битрикс24-amoCRM", вендорские модули, маркетплейс amoCRM. От 15 до 60 тысяч в год лицензия плюс 20-60 тысяч за настройку у вендора. Работает, пока ваш бизнес похож на типовой кейс: одна номенклатурная группа, простая структура контрагентов, односторонняя синхронизация. Под нестандартный кейс начинает сыпаться и доводится только через "купите тариф выше".
Кастомный коннектор от интегратора. 150-400 тысяч единоразово плюс 8-20 тысяч в месяц поддержки. Этот вариант гибкий: учитывает вашу логику, есть логи, мониторинг, нормальная обработка ошибок. Окупается, если у вас от 50-100 сделок в день и каждая ошибка стоит времени менеджера. Срок проекта 3-6 недель.
Через middleware (n8n, Make, кастомный микросервис). 80-180 тысяч единоразово, ниже стоимость поддержки. Меньше зависимость от одного вендора, есть прозрачность каждого шага обмена. Минус - нужно поднимать инфраструктуру (где будет крутиться n8n или сервис). Подходит, когда планируете обмен не только с 1С, но и с маркетплейсом, MyWarehouse, банком одновременно.
Если хочется быстрый ответ: для бизнеса со средним объёмом 200-500 сделок в месяц нормальный кастом обойдётся в 250 тысяч под ключ плюс 15 тысяч в месяц поддержки. Это и есть та сумма, на которую стоит ориентироваться, когда вам в коммерческом предложении пишут "от 50 тысяч за интеграцию" - будьте готовы доплачивать.
Что спрашивать у интегратора, чтобы не попасть
- Какие именно сущности синхронизируются? (Сделки, контрагенты, остатки, цены, платежи, документы.)
- Это одностороннее движение из amoCRM в 1С или двустороннее?
- Как обрабатываются ошибки? Логируются куда, кто получает уведомления?
- Что происходит, если 1С временно недоступна?
- Как защищены от дублей при повторных webhook'ах?
- Будет ли работать после обновления 1С?
- Что входит в поддержку и за сколько, что не входит?
Если на любой из этих вопросов ответ "мы не настраивали такое, но это уточним по ходу" - значит, по ходу будет ещё один счёт.
Что делать, если интеграция уже есть и течёт
Сначала аудит. Прогон 50 случайных сделок за последний месяц со сравнением "в amoCRM закрылась" против "в 1С появился документ реализации". Если совпадение меньше 95%, у вас не интеграция, а лотерея. Дальше выясняется, на каком шаге теряется (контрагент не находится, номенклатура не маппится, webhook не дошёл).
После аудита решение из трёх вариантов: чинить точечно (если течь конкретная), переделывать обмен (если фундамент кривой), оставлять как есть и закладывать ручную сверку (если объём маленький).
Близкая тема в блоге: про подбор CRM писал в Битрикс24 или amoCRM, а как не переплатить за саму интеграцию разбирал в API-интеграция без мистики. Если задача шире и стоит вопрос "что собирать первым", есть гайд по приоритетам в Автоматизация бизнеса 2026.
Короткий чек-лист перед интеграцией
- [ ] У вас нормализована номенклатура в 1С, дубли убраны
- [ ] У контрагентов есть ИНН, и он используется как ключ сверки
- [ ] Определены типы цен и правило выбора в момент сделки
- [ ] Решено, будет ли двусторонняя синхронизация (и заложено в бюджет)
- [ ] Есть план логирования и алертов на ошибки обмена
- [ ] Заложены 60 дней гарантии и поддержки после запуска
- [ ] Заложено хотя бы 4 часа в месяц на регламентный мониторинг
Если хотя бы три галочки не стоит, не торопитесь подписывать договор. Лучше потратить две недели на нормализацию данных, чем три месяца на героическую борьбу с дублями.
Когда соберётесь делать, пришлите бриф - посчитаю, что реально нужно, что можно убрать, какой коннектор подойдёт под ваш объём. Бесплатно, до старта работ.
Есть процесс, который пора отдать машине?
Опишите задачу в брифе - верну оценку с ценой и сроками за 24 часа. Бесплатно, до подписания.
Оставить заявку